The processes that are applied in order to maximise the returns by effective administration of property are together referred to as ‘property management’.
It is one of the major assets of most of the organizations. Besides, it also includes all the disciplines that are implemented on property rules and rental policies.
In other words, ‘Property Management’ is yet another career profession, which is a part of the growing business industry.
A property manager’s employment can be in either of the following ways:
Directly under the supervision of a real estate property owner.
For a property management company.
Hired by a legal entity to look after the real estate for a certain period of time.
Following are certain roles played by a property management company and the property managers. These roles are more or less similar to the roles played by management in any business.
It takes the responsibility of managing the multiple aspects involved in the ownership of real estate.
It acts as a liaison between the landlord and tenant. In this case, they perform duties like posing appropriate gross rent, responding to and addressing maintenance issues, accepting rent, advertising vacancies for landlords, doing credit and background checks on tenant, etc.
Apart from managing income and expense related activities, property managers are also required to manage construction, development, repair and maintenance.
It is quite essential for the property managers to maintain good relation with the management company, property owner and tenants.
Initiating a ‘litigation’ with tenants, contractors and insurance agencies is an important aspect of this profession. However, it is an entirely independent function meant only for the trained attorneys.
They also look into legal aspects like evictions, non-payment, harassment, reduction of pre-arranged services, public nuisance, etc.
Following are some characteristics of an ideal property manager:
He should have an updated knowledge about new laws and practices in the given localities, cities and states.
He should also stay updated on local ordinances.
He should be very honest while enforcing property rules and rental policies.
He is expected to be well oriented and organized with paper works.
He ought to have good communication and computer skills.
He should not refrain from working with the public.
He should have a strong sense of duty and commitment.
